Questions & Answers
The cheapest way to get from Phoenix to Fruita is to drive which costs $100 - $150 and takes 10h 17m.
The fastest way to get from Phoenix to Fruita is to fly which takes 2h 48m and costs $550 - $1,800.
The distance between Phoenix and Fruita is 455 miles. The road distance is 555.1 miles.
The best way to get from Phoenix to Fruita without a car is to bus and train which takes 21h 16m and costs $290 - $470.
It takes approximately 2h 48m to get from Phoenix to Fruita, including transfers.
The best way to get from Phoenix to Fruita is to fly which takes 2h 48m and costs $550 - $1,800. Alternatively, you can bus, which costs $240 - $420 and takes 25h 39m.
Fruita is 1h ahead of Phoenix. It is currently 7:32 AM in Phoenix and 8:32 AM in Fruita.
Yes, the driving distance between Phoenix to Fruita is 555 miles. It takes approximately 10h 17m to drive from Phoenix to Fruita.
There are 107+ hotels available in Fruita.
What companies run services between Phoenix, AZ, USA and Fruita, CO, USA?
American Airlines and Delta fly from Phoenix (PHX) to Grand Junction Regional Airport (GJT) 4 times a day.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Phoenix Bus Station to Fruita via Las Vegas Bus Terminal, Glenwood Springs, Hwy 6 + Soccer Field Rd, West Glenwood Park & Ride, and Grand Junction Regional Airport in around 25h 39m.
